Reporting Animal Abuse: Your Guide to Justice

Witnessing animal maltreatment can be deeply disturbing. It's crucial to remember that you are not alone and there are steps you can take to support these vulnerable creatures. By notifying suspected animal abuse, you become a voice for those who cannot speak for themselves and play a role in bringing about justice. The first step is to gather as much information as possible.

Document the date, time, location, and a comprehensive description of the incident. If it is safe to do so, photograph the abuse, but prioritize your own safety. Next, contact your local animal welfare organization or law authorities. They will be able to provide guidance and initiate the appropriate actions.

Remember, every notification has the potential to protect an animal from further injury.
